The resolution mourns the passing of the Honorable Robert Lee Wilder, affectionately known as "Cookie Man," who died on March 19, 2025, at the age of 68. A resident of Aliceville, Alabama, Wilder was a beloved figure in his community, known for his dedication to public service and his contributions to local sports. He had a diverse career, starting as a stocker in his youth, becoming a successful auto mechanic, and serving as a Certified Diesel Mechanic for over three decades. Wilder was also an active member of the Aliceville City Council, where he served four consecutive terms, and was involved in various civic organizations, including coaching youth sports and directing the city park.
The resolution highlights Wilder's numerous achievements and the impact he had on his community, including being named Aliceville Citizen of the Year in 2015. His commitment to public service and community engagement is celebrated, and the resolution expresses heartfelt condolences to his family and friends, acknowledging the significant loss felt by all who knew him. The Alabama Legislature officially records his death with deep sadness and honors his legacy through this tribute.
